I may be corrected but a placing is different from a rights issue (or an open offer) where punters like you an me get a chance to buy. With a placing you go straight to the institutional investors and they get a sweet deal. Apparently it's much cheaper to do, but it certainly screws the PI's. Pter Blezard sent an email to Atrocity Exhibition on iii explaining that 15p was the best price they could get in the current market.
